I agree! I remember kissing my new husband on the international bridge in Captain Olivers and dancing on the dance floor as newlyweds. The Dutch side has been collecting taxes from Captain Oliver's for a hotel that is on the French side and Leasing water rights as well not even knowing where the border is. If SXM wants to attract investors to either side this must be resolved in a timely manner!
